Essential Web Development Considerations for Small BusinessesIllustration
web development fundamentals

Essential Web Development Considerations for Small Businesses

The Foundation of Web Development

Creating a visually appealing and functional website is crucial for any business aiming to establish a robust online presence. For non-tech savvy business owners, understanding the basics of web development can provide a clearer path to achieving digital success without feeling overwhelmed. This article will shed light on the essential components you need to consider.

Understanding Your Business Needs

Defining Your Website’s Purpose

Before diving into the details of web development, it’s vital to define the primary purpose of your website. Are you creating an e-commerce platform, a blog, or a portfolio? Clear objectives will guide the development process and ensure that the final product aligns with your business goals.

Target Audience Identification

Knowing your target audience influences the design, content, and features of your website. Conduct thorough market research to understand your audience’s preferences and browsing behaviors. This will help in creating a user-friendly website that can engage and convert visitors effectively.

Key Elements of Web Development

Choosing the Right Domain Name

Your domain name is your online identity. It should be easy to remember, relevant to your business, and include keywords that help in improving search engine rankings. Tools like domain name generators can help simplify this process.

Selecting a Web Hosting Service

Reliable web hosting services are crucial for ensuring your website is always accessible. Look for hosting providers that offer excellent uptime, security features, and customer support. Common options include shared hosting, VPS hosting, and dedicated servers. Select the one that best fits your business size and traffic expectations.

Building a High-Quality User Interface (UI) and User Experience (UX)

The design and navigation of your website significantly impact user satisfaction. A well-designed UI ensures that visitors find what they’re looking for quickly, while good UX keeps them engaged with intuitive and enjoyable interactions. Consider hiring a professional designer to bring your vision to life.

Content Management Systems (CMS)

Comparing Popular CMS Options

Content Management Systems (CMS) enable you to easily update and maintain your website. Popular options include WordPress, Joomla, and Drupal. Each has its pros and cons, so choose one that aligns with your technical skills and the complexity of your website. WordPress, for instance, is user-friendly and offers extensive plugin options.

Essential Web Development Tools

Integrated Development Environments (IDEs)

An Integrated Development Environment (IDE) helps developers write and edit code more efficiently. Tools like Visual Studio Code, Sublime Text, and Atom can significantly streamline the development process.

Version Control Systems (VCS)

Version control systems like Git help manage changes to your website’s code, ensuring that you can track modifications and revert to previous versions if needed. GitHub and GitLab are popular platforms that offer robust version control features.

SEO and Web Development

On-Page SEO Best Practices

Integrating SEO strategies during the web development process can enhance your site's visibility on search engines. Focus on optimizing elements such as title tags, meta descriptions, headers, and image alt texts. Ensure fast loading speeds and mobile responsiveness to further boost your rankings.

Technical SEO Considerations

Implementing proper technical SEO practices, such as XML sitemaps, structured data, and canonical tags, helps search engines crawl and index your site more effectively. Leveraging Google Search Console can provide insights into your site’s performance and identify areas for improvement.

Conclusion

Understanding the fundamental aspects of web development allows business owners to make informed decisions and collaborate effectively with developers. By focusing on your business needs, key development elements, and integrating SEO best practices, you can create a website that not only looks great but performs exceptionally well, contributing to your overall business success.

Related Articles

Discover articles tailored to your interests, providing deeper insights and extended learning opportunities. Our "Related Articles" feature connects you with content that complements your current read, ensuring you have all the knowledge you need to make informed decisions about your business's online presence.